Quote:
Originally Posted by KrisisOD View Post
I'm currently sitting at the dealership due to 4th gear grinding..

Ah that sucks...

I have 2nd gear grinding and the only way to prevent it is to either shift at a high RPM (~3500) or to wait until the revs drop when the clutch is in. Only problem with the latter is that I have to slip the clutch to when I engage it to 3rd.

Let us know what they do with yours. When I brought my car to show the tech, the transmission was smooth as butter so he told me to break it in more...

Btw 3rd to 4th is my smoothest & most effortless shift. Weird how inconsistent the transmissions are.
